What Is King Power Mahanakhon?
King Power Mahanakhon is Bangkokβs most iconic modern landmark, a pixelated skyscraper rising 314 meters above the city skyline.
Located in the Sathorn district, itβs home to the famous Mahanakhon SkyWalk, Thailandβs highest observation deck, offering 360Β° panoramic views across Bangkok and beyond.
Whether youβre visiting for sunset views, the glass skywalk experience, or skyline photography, Mahanakhon is one of the most memorable attractions in the city.
Completed in 2016, the tower became Thailandβs tallest building at the time. Its distinctive βpixel-cutβ design makes it one of the most recognizable buildings in Southeast Asia.
Inside youβll find: Indoor observation deck (74th floor). Rooftop SkyWalk (78th floor). Glass floor experience. Sky bar. Exhibition zone explaining Bangkokβs skyline
Itβs a modern contrast to Bangkokβs historic temples, and thatβs exactly why itβs worth visiting.
The Mahanakhon SkyWalk Experience
The highlight is the glass tray floor on the rooftop. You step onto a transparent platform suspended 300+ meters above ground level. Itβs safe, monitored, and surprisingly thrilling, especially at sunset when the city lights begin to glow. Expect: Security screening. Shoe covers for the glass floor. Moderate crowds at sunset. Clear skyline views toward the Chao Phraya River. If heights make you nervous, you can still enjoy the 360Β° terrace without stepping onto the glass.

Best Time to Visit:
Sunset (5 PM β 7 PM) β Most popular. Golden hour skyline views and dramatic city lighting transition.
Evening (After 7 PM) β Cooler temperatures, sparkling city lights, romantic atmosphere.
Morning β Least crowded with clearer visibility, though less dramatic.
Avoid heavy rain season days for best visibility. How to Get to King Power Mahanakhon The easiest way: BTS Skytrain,
Chong Nonsi Station >, exit directly connected to the building. This makes it one of the most accessible attractions in Bangkok.
How Long Do You Need?
Plan 1β1.5 hours including: Elevator ride. Exhibition. Rooftop. Photos. It pairs well with: Sathorn dinner. Silom night market. Lumphini Park. A rooftop bar evening
